Uttarakhand: On Tuesday, on the occasion of Home Guard Foundation Day, a ceremonial parade was organized by the jawans in Uttarakhand. Where the Chief Minister of the state Pushkar Singh Dhami along with Commandant General Kewal Khurana arrived to inspect this parade. During this, the tableau of Civil Defense Organization was also seen. At the same time, the soldiers of the Home Guard showed many tricks. Apart from this, CM Dhami encouraged the youth with his statement. At the same time, the Chief Minister also honored the Home Guard on this occasion. Apart from this, the CM also made several announcements.
App inaugurated for health checkup
Praising the jawans, Chief Minister Dhami said that Home Guards contribute shoulder to shoulder with the police in law and order. At the same time, under the Civil Defense Organization in the state, they help the citizens in every small and big disaster. On the other hand, he also inaugurated a mobile app named ‘Pahal’ to take care of the mental health of the home guards. Through this app, youth can consult psychologists. Apart from this, this app is also useful for mental peace. This is the first such app in the country. This app has been made in collaboration with the School of Life organization. At the same time, the CM also said that “our government is ready to provide all kinds of cooperation to them (home guards).”

CM Dhami made many announcements
The Chief Minister of Uttarakhand has asked to recruit one female platoon (total number-330) of women home guards volunteers in 10 districts of the state. On the other hand, it has been announced to provide food allowance of Rs 180 per day to the volunteers doing duty in the districts and election duty in the state border and posted in the parade. Apart from this, the CM has announced to provide duty allowance to Home Guards volunteers for a maximum period of 6 months for hospitalization for the entire service period, if they are injured or ill within 24 hours of Home Guards duty. At the same time, the Chief Minister has announced Rs 1500 per month instead of 1000 to unpaid platoon commander, Rs 1200 to 2000 per month to unpaid assistant company commander and Rs 2500 instead of 1500 to unpaid company commander.
